#include "tommath_private.h" #ifdef BN_MP_INIT_C /* LibTomMath, multiple-precision integer library -- Tom St Denis */ /* SPDX-License-Identifier: Unlicense */ /* init a new mp_int */ mp_err mp_init(mp_int *a) { /* allocate memory required and clear it */ a->dp = (mp_digit *) MP_CALLOC((size_t)MP_PREC, sizeof(mp_digit)); if (a->dp == NULL) { return MP_MEM; } /* set the used to zero, allocated digits to the default precision * and sign to positive */ a->used = 0; a->alloc = MP_PREC; a->sign = MP_ZPOS; return MP_OKAY; } #endif
